HC Deb 03 February 1948 vol 446 cc1611-2
4. Mr. Prescott

asked the Minister of Labour what is the policy of His Majesty's Government in regard to co-partnership and profit-sharing schemes in industry.

Mr. Isaacs

I would refer the hon. Member to the reply which I gave to the hon. Member for South Edinburgh (Sir W. Darling) on 9th December last.

Mr. Thornton-Kemsley

Is there any significance in the fact that the Labour Party's most recent publication upon industrial democracy makes no mention whatever, in its 8,000 words, about the importance of co-partnership in industry, which surely is the essence of industrial democracy?

Mr. Isaacs

I am not responsible for what the party has issued.

Mr. Heathcoat Amory

Does the right hon. Gentleman agree that schemes of this kind help to identify the interests of employers and employees?

Mr. Speaker

That is a matter of opinion.

Mr. Isaacs

That is a matter of personal opinion which I am not called upon to express.
